Sour Cream Raisin Pie III

Submitted by: Carol 
This version of a classic pie is wonderfully spiced with nutmeg, cloves and cinnamon. The spices are stirred into a sweet sour cream and raisin filling that is poured into a pastry crust. The pie bakes in under an hour and is best served warm with whipped cream.

Sour Cream Raisin Pie I

Submitted by: Glenda 
This pie 's thick and creamy custard is made with raisins, sour cream, sugar, eggs, lemon juice and cornstarch. They are cooked and stirred until thick, and then the filling is poured into a prepared pie shell and chilled. The top is slathered with more sour cream, and then the pie is thoroughly chilled before serving.

Sour Cream Raisin Pie II

Submitted by: Kevin Ryan 
This wonderful pie is made with golden raisins and real maple syrup with a generous sprinkling of nutmeg. Sour cream, sugar, eggs, flour, maple syrup, nutmeg and vanilla are stirred up together, and then the filling is poured into a pastry shell lined with raisins. Then the pie is baked, chilled and served.

Sour Cream Apple Pie II

Submitted by: Julie Grieger 
This is a twice-baked pie studded with a creamy sour cream filling that 's full of apples. The crust and filling is baked together for 45 minutes, and then the pie is topped with a buttery sugar crumble and returned to the oven until it 's golden.

Sour Cream Apple Pie I

Submitted by: JJOHN32 
Diced apples are stirred into a mixture of sour cream, nutmeg, sugar, flour and egg. This chunky filling is then poured into a prepared crust and baked. While still warm, it 's topped with a crumble made of cinnamon, sugar and butter, and then it 's baked until the topping is melted and glazed over the pie. Cool and serve this luscious pie with vanilla ice cream.

Pineapple Sour Cream Pie

Submitted by: Carol 
A wonderful sour cream and pineapple custard is cooked slowly on the stove until thick and creamy. When cool, it 's poured into a graham cracker crust, covered with a sweetened whipped meringue, and baked until the swirls of meringue are golden.
